Top 10 Low-Cost Medical Colleges in Bangladesh for Indian Students
Affordable Yet High Quality
While premium colleges like Dhaka National and Holy Family command fees upwards of $45,000, there are several highly reputed, NMC-approved medical colleges in Bangladesh that offer the same identical curriculum and excellent clinical exposure at a fraction of the cost.
The Top Low-Cost Options for 2026
- Ad-Din Women's Medical College (Dhaka): Primarily for female students, this college is incredibly safe, highly disciplined, and costs roughly $36,000 for the entire 5 years. It is known for strict academics.
- Jahurul Islam Medical College: Located outside the hustle of Dhaka, this college boasts a massive 500-bed hospital and offers a very peaceful environment. Total tuition fees are approximately $39,000.
- Eastern Medical College (Comilla): An excellent choice near the Tripura border. It is highly popular among students from Northeast India and West Bengal. Fees range around $43,000.
- Monno Medical College: Situated in Manikganj, this college offers great infrastructure and a large patient inflow at around $40,000.
- International Medical College: Located on the outskirts of Dhaka, it offers a serene campus and excellent Indian food facilities for roughly $42,000.
Important Budgeting Tip
When selecting a low-cost college, always verify if the quoted package includes hostel accommodation. Some colleges quote $35,000 but charge $100/month separately for the hostel, which adds $6,000 to your total budget over 5 years.
